Laura began as a large tropical wave that emerged off the west coast of Africa on August 16 th.The wave traversed the tropical Atlantic for the next several days with little additional organization. Laura's maximum sustained winds jumped from 75 mph to 140 mph in the 24 hours ending 1 p.m. CDT Wednesday. Last night, Hurricane Laura made landfall on the southwestern coast of Louisiana, bring heavy rain (6-8 inches), strong winds (gusting to 132 mph at one location), and a coastal storm surge (roughly 10 feet at the most vulnerable locations).
